Our Facilities

In addition to our gallery spaces the Vermont Center for Photography boasts a fully equipped traditional black and white darkroom, one of only two publicly accessible darkrooms in the state.
We are currently in the planning stages for on-site digital imaging facilities. Darkroom rental rates are $15 an hour for non-members, $10 an hour for VCP members.
